Output c4a1b06e36c871503d554644527d4c045060f77090f5aa76e6e3484778174e78:9

value
111128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db4d95b5ed8b30ebdb422130bc8e81530da0df4b OP_EQUAL
address
3MgarExkmMuGPf7ggVodjLmb2TTAD2ufQn
transaction
c4a1b06e36c871503d554644527d4c045060f77090f5aa76e6e3484778174e78
confirmations
189127
spent
true